Aires 35-V - Camera-wiki.org - The free camera encyclopedia
Aug 31, 2024 · Advanced features included a built-in selenium meter, an interchangeable lens mount in front of a central leaf shutter, parallax-corrected brightline viewfinder, and (at launch) the S Coral 45mm f/1.5 lens as standard. Several interchangeable lenses were offered: 35mm f/3.2, 100mm f/3.5, and eventually three 45mm options (f/1.5, f/1.8, and f/1.9).

Aires 35-V Camera at Historic Camera
Jun 13, 2015 · The camera featured interchangeable lens, and a built-in un-coupled selenium type light meter, coupled range finder, flash synchronization, and a rapid action film advance. The lenses mounted on a Seikosha-MX leaf shutter operating from 1 to 1/400 of a second, plus Bulb. CLICK HERE for a list of Aires Cameras.
